According to Glassdoor, the estimated total pay for a product manager in the United States is about $156,737 annually, with an average salary of about $125,609 annually. However, it's essential to note that these figures can fluctuate depending on the economic situation, industry, company size, geographic location, and the individual's skill level.
Product managers play a significant role in leading products from inception to market. They are in charge of long-term planning, ensuring effective collaboration between teams, and occasionally across departments. Their expertise significantly impacts the product's success by aligning it with market demands and business objectives.
To become a product manager, you need to develop diverse skills such as an understanding of various technical processes, problem-solving, data analysis, and excellent soft skills. Although there are no specific educational requirements, it is usual for product managers to have backgrounds in business, marketing, or related fields.
